| Main Entry: | citizen |
| Part of Speech: | noun |
| Definition: | person native of country |
Synonyms: |
John/Jane Q. Public, aborigine, burgess, burgher, civilian, commoner, cosmopolite, denizen, dweller, freeman/woman, householder, inhabitant, member of body politic, member of community, national, native, naturalized person, occupant, resident, settler, subject, taxpayer, townsperson, urbanite, villager, voter |
| Notes: | a denizen is someone who inhabits a particular place while a citizen is a native or naturalized member of a state, city, town, or other political community |
Antonyms: |
alien, foreigner, immigrant |
